### The MQI Research Study 

 

The MQI research study included the development and implementation of the [MQI Coaching Cycle](https://mqicoaching.cepr.harvard.edu/coaching-cycle), as well as a rigorous evaluation of the program’s effectiveness using a teacher-level random assignment design.
